Watering, pruning, propagation, and repotting details from plant data
Keep the soil consistently moist but not waterlogged. Allow the top 2-3 cm of soil to dry out between waterings. Reduce watering during winter months.
Yellowing leaves can indicate overwatering, while wilting suggests it's too dry.
Prune to maintain shape and encourage bushier growth. Remove any dead, damaged, or leggy stems by cutting them back to a healthy leaf node.
Light pruning can be done at any time, but heavier pruning is best done in spring before new growth begins.
Easily propagated from stem cuttings. Take 7-10 cm cuttings from healthy stems, remove lower leaves, and dip the cut end in rooting hormone.
Plant in moist, well-draining potting mix and keep in a warm, humid environment until roots form.
Repot every 1-2 years or when the plant becomes root-bound. Use a well-draining potting mix. Choose a pot only slightly larger than the current one to avoid overwatering issues.
Repot in spring before the main growing season begins.
